Understanding the Biology GCSE Foundation Tier

The biology GCSE foundation tier is part of the broader GCSE Science curriculum,

specifically tailored to students who prefer a less complex approach compared to the

higher tier. It focuses on fundamental biological principles, ensuring that learners develop

a clear understanding of key topics without the pressure of overly detailed content. This

tier is ideal for students who want to secure a good grade while building essential

scientific literacy.

Who Is the Foundation Tier For?

Not every student finds the higher tier suitable, which often involves more in-depth

knowledge and challenging exam questions. The foundation tier caters to learners who:

Are new to biology or find science challenging.

Want to build confidence before advancing to higher-level studies.

Aim to achieve grades from 1 to 5 (or equivalent, depending on the exam board).

Prefer a straightforward, practical approach to scientific concepts.

This tier ensures that all students, regardless of their starting point, can engage

meaningfully with biology and develop skills that will serve them in further education or

everyday life.

Core Topics Covered in Biology GCSE Foundation Tier

One of the strengths of the biology GCSE foundation tier is its clear focus on essential

biological themes. Here’s a breakdown of the main areas you’ll encounter, along with

some tips to master each.

Cell Biology

At the heart of biology lies the cell, the basic unit of life. Understanding cell structure and

function is crucial in the foundation tier.

Learn the difference between plant and animal cells, including components like the

nucleus, cytoplasm, and cell membrane.

Explore cell specialization and how cells form tissues, organs, and systems.

Practice drawing and labelling cell diagrams accurately.

Understand basic cell processes such as diffusion and osmosis.

Getting comfortable with these concepts will help you grasp how life functions at the

microscopic level.

Organisation of Living Things

This section explores how cells organize into tissues, organs, and systems to maintain life.

Study the major human organ systems, including the digestive, respiratory,

circulatory, and nervous systems.

Recognize the role of different organs and how they work together.

Learn key processes like digestion, respiration, and blood circulation.

Understand health and disease basics, such as the impact of pathogens and the

immune response.

Visual aids and real-life examples can make these topics more engaging and easier to

remember.

Infection and Response

Disease and the body’s defense mechanisms form an important component in the

foundation tier.

Identify common pathogens including bacteria, viruses, fungi, and protists.

Learn how diseases spread and ways to prevent infection.

Study the immune system’s role, including vaccinations and antibiotics.

Understand symptoms and treatments of common illnesses.

This topic connects biology to everyday life, making it particularly relevant and

interesting.

Bioenergetics

This area covers how organisms obtain and use energy.

Understand photosynthesis basics and why plants are vital for life on Earth.

Learn about respiration in plants and animals.

Explore how energy transformations support growth and activity.

Simple experiments or demonstrations can reinforce these concepts effectively.

Ecology and Environment

Ecology introduces learners to relationships within ecosystems and environmental

concerns.

Study food chains, food webs, and energy flow.

Learn about habitats, biodiversity, and adaptation.

Understand human impact on the environment, including pollution and

conservation.

This topic encourages awareness of sustainability, an increasingly important global issue.

Question

Answer

What is the difference

between plant and animal

cells?

Plant cells have a cell wall, chloroplasts, and a large

central vacuole, while animal cells do not. Both have a cell

membrane, cytoplasm, and a nucleus.

What is photosynthesis and

where does it occur?

Photosynthesis is the process by which green plants use

sunlight to make food (glucose) from carbon dioxide and

water. It occurs in the chloroplasts of plant cells.

What are the main stages

of the human digestive

system?

The main stages are ingestion (eating), digestion (breaking

down food), absorption (nutrients absorbed into the

blood), and egestion (removal of waste). Key organs

include the mouth, stomach, small intestine, and large

intestine.

How do enzymes work in

the body?

Enzymes are biological catalysts that speed up chemical

reactions in the body by lowering the activation energy

needed. Each enzyme is specific to a particular reaction or

substrate.

What is the function of the

respiratory system?

The respiratory system allows gas exchange, bringing

oxygen into the body and removing carbon dioxide from

the bloodstream, primarily through the lungs.

How is genetic information

inherited?

Genetic information is inherited through genes located on

chromosomes. Offspring receive half of their chromosomes

from each parent, which determines inherited traits.

Assessment Structure and Grading

Assessment in the biology GCSE foundation tier is designed to evaluate understanding

through a combination of multiple-choice, structured, and short-answer questions.

Typically, exams are divided into two papers, each lasting around 1 hour and 15 minutes,

covering different modules.

One of the notable differences between the foundation and higher tiers lies in the grading

boundaries. Foundation tier grades range from 1 to 5, with 5 being the top achievable

grade, whereas the higher tier extends to grade 9. This grading system reflects the tier’s

intended accessibility, allowing students to secure a pass without the depth required by

the higher tier.

Comparative Insights: Foundation vs. Higher Tier

Evaluating the biology GCSE foundation tier alongside the higher tier reveals nuanced

differences beyond content complexity. The higher tier encompasses additional topics

such as detailed biochemistry, advanced genetics, and more rigorous application of

scientific principles.

From an assessment perspective, higher tier exams demand analytical skills, extended

responses, and problem-solving abilities. In contrast, the foundation tier prioritizes recall,

comprehension, and straightforward application.

However, it is important to note that the foundation tier does not dilute scientific integrity

but rather adapts the curriculum to diverse learner needs. This inclusivity aligns with

educational goals of broadening participation and fostering foundational scientific literacy.

Impact on Future Academic and Career Paths

The choice between foundation and higher tiers can influence subsequent educational

trajectories. Students who excel in the foundation tier may still pursue science-related

qualifications but may need to supplement their learning to meet A-Level entry

requirements, which often prefer higher-tier GCSE grades.

Conversely, the foundation tier suits students targeting vocational courses,

apprenticeships, or careers where a basic understanding of biology suffices. Careers in

healthcare support, environmental management, or laboratory technician roles may value

the foundational knowledge provided by this tier.
